Würth Elektronik 18012115411H is used in Digital Isolators category where integration and verification need to stay predictable. Key specs include Description (DGTL ISOLTR 3.75KV 2CH CAN 8SOIC), Series (WPME-CDIS), Packaging (Tape & Reel (TR), Cut Tape (CT)), Temperature (-40°C ~ 125°C), and Package/case (8-SOIC (0.154", 3.90mm Width)).

Isolation strategy is treated as a system-level choice that interacts with grounding, creepage/clearance, EMC, and safety compliance. In practice, a well-designed isolation boundary improves robustness and reduces field failures caused by transients and ground shifts. In industrial automation, isolation protects low-voltage domains from ground shifts on long field wiring. Within motor drives and power supplies, isolated feedback and control paths tolerate high dv/dt switching and help meet safety and EMC requirements. In medical and instrumentation equipment, isolation supports patient/operator safety and reduces measurement error caused by ground loops and common-mode interference.
